In the world of engineering, the seat poppet valve plays a crucial role in various applications, particularly in the automotive and aerospace industries. This type of valve is designed to control the flow of fluids or gases, ensuring optimal performance and efficiency in machinery. Understanding the functionality and significance of seat poppet valves can help engineers and technicians make informed decisions when designing and maintaining systems.
A seat poppet valve consists of a movable disc, or poppet, that seals against a seat to control the flow of fluid. When the valve is closed, the poppet sits firmly against the seat, preventing any flow. When the valve opens, the poppet lifts away from the seat, allowing fluid to pass through. This simple yet effective mechanism is what makes seat poppet valves a popular choice in various applications, from internal combustion engines to hydraulic systems.
One of the key advantages of seat poppet valves is their ability to provide precise control over fluid flow. This precision is essential in applications where maintaining specific pressure levels is critical. For instance, in an internal combustion engine, the timing of the valve opening and closing directly impacts the engine’s efficiency and performance. A well-functioning seat poppet valve ensures that the right amount of air and fuel enters the combustion chamber, optimizing power output and reducing emissions.
Moreover, seat poppet valves are known for their durability and reliability. Made from high-quality materials, they can withstand extreme temperatures and pressures, making them suitable for demanding environments. Regular maintenance and inspection of these valves are essential to ensure their longevity and performance.
